What is a SMAS Facelift?

The SMAS (Superficial Musculo-Aponeurotic System) facelift goes beyond the fundamental skin-tightening practices of traditional facelifts. Alternatively, it targets raising and repositioning the main facial muscles and fat while preserving the skin's organic alignment. That deeper method not only promotes the quick visual effects but in addition ensures they last more than surface-level procedures.

What Makes a SMAS Facelift Unique?

Among the critical differentiators of a SMAS facelift is its targeted approach. By emphasizing the greater SMAS coating of facial muscle, surgeons can handle signals of ageing such as for instance sagging cheeks, deep nasolabial creases, and jowls effectively. The method ensures the overall facial structure remains beneficial, avoiding the over-tightened, unnatural search that some standard facelifts produce.
